Production Notes:
When I had an exhibition in Chengdu, China, a Tibetan Buddhist high monk happened to visit my work. He invited me to join a drawing retreat with his brother, who is a Tibetan Buddhist painter. I accepted, without knowing that his home was at an altitude of 3,500 meters.
I have no religion, but before going there I studied what Tibetan Buddhism is, including its paintings. There are works called thangka and mandala. In both, the subject, composition, and geometric layout are strictly decided based on Buddhist teachings, and the artist paints very carefully within those rules.
Using the ideas behind this geometric structure and composition, I combined the themes I was exploring at that time: reincarnation, the beginning of life, reproduction, and the end of life. By coincidence, Tibetan Buddhism also has the idea of rebirth, so it connected well with my own theme. While painting, I felt a strange sense of familiarity, as if it was something I already knew.
